温馨提示:这篇文章已超过454天没有更新,请注意相关的内容是否还可用!
摘要:本内容是关于华为OD机试中的字符串比较题目,涉及Java、JavaScript、Python、C和C++等编程语言。题目要求对各种编程语言中的字符串进行比较操作,考察考生对字符串处理和数据结构的掌握程度。免费题库提供练习,帮助考生提高编程能力和算法水平。
须知
亲爱的读者们,本试题库完全免费提供,我们采取收费措施是为了防止内容被非法爬取,如果您订阅了专栏并希望退款,请私信联系我们,感谢您的支持与理解。
文章目录
1、须知
2、题目描述
3、输入描述
4、输出描述
5、用例
6、解题思路
* Java代码实现
* JavaScript代码实现
* Python代码实现
* C++代码实现
题目描述
给定两个长度相等的字符串A和B,以及一个正整数V,我们需要找到A中的最大连续子串,该子串在A和B中的位置和长度均相同,并且满足条件:子串中每个对应字符的ASCII码之差的绝对值之和不超过V,请计算并返回这个最大连续子串的长度。
输入描述
输入包含三行:
1、第一行包含字符串A。
2、第二行包含字符串B。
3、第三行包含一个正整数V。
输入的字符串仅包含小写字母,且长度相等,输入的整数V不会超过任何字符的ASCII码之差,输入的字符串长度不超过某个固定值(具体数值可根据实际情况设定)。abcdefg abcdefg 10
表示字符串A为abcdefg,字符串B也为abcdefg,整数V为10,每个字符串的长度不超过一定范围(不超过某个固定值),请根据实际情况设定具体数值。
文章版权声明:除非注明,否则均为VPS857原创文章,转载或复制请以超链接形式并注明出处。
还没有评论,来说两句吧...